Mikko Myllykoski is Experience Director at Heureka, The Finnish Science Centre. He may be contacted at Mikko.Myllykoski@heureka.fi. The science center field is young and rapidly growing. Some start the counting from the Exploratorium and the Ontario Science Centre in 1969. Twenty years later there were 240 science centers worldwide, today more than 2400. One of the institutions that was opened in 1989, is Heureka, the Finnish science centre, a museum that on an average attracts 280,000 visitors annually in a 2-hour drive catchment area of 2,100,000 inhabitants. We wanted to pay homage to the achievements of the field by designing a whole exhibition gallery, Heureka Classics, for its 20th anniversary. The idea was to recycle some of our very best exhibits, many known from the Exploratorium Cookbook, some from Galileo Galilei or other scientists and inventors, for this millennium.
